Abstract
Solution ring-chain reactions of poly(butylene terephthalate) (PBT) we re carried out using 1,2-dichlorobenzene (b.p. 180 degrees C) with a c atalyst. By increasing the dilution to 1:70 (polymer/solvent ratio w/v ), cyclic PBT oligomers were obtained in a yield of 70 wt%. This compa res to cyclic oligomers of PBT extracted from commercial PBT chip usin g mixed xylene isomers, in a yield of 1 wt%. The cyclic oligomers prod uced in the solution ring-chain reaction and obtained from the extract were found to contain oligomers (CO.C6H4CO.O.(CH2)(4)O)(x), where x = 2-9. The cyclic oligomers of PBT were analysed using PL-gel mixed E g el permeation chromatographic columns, fast atom bombardment mass spec trometry and liquid chromatography tandem mass spectrometry. The cycli c dimer of PBT, (CO.C6H4CO.O.(CH2)(4)O)(2), was separated, purified an d crystallized and its X-ray crystal structure determined. (C) 1997 El sevier Science Ltd.
